About 3,6-dimethoxy-2-propan-2-yl-5-[1-[4-(trifluoromethyl)phenyl]ethyl]-2,5-dihydropyrazine
3,6-dimethoxy-2-propan-2-yl-5-[1-[4-(trifluoromethyl)phenyl]ethyl]-2,5-dihydropyrazine (PubChem CID 91256943) has the molecular formula C18H23F3N2O2
and a molecular weight of 356.39 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3,6-dimethoxy-2-propan-2-yl-5-[1-[4-(trifluoromethyl)phenyl]ethyl]-2,5-dihydropyrazine.

What is the SMILES notation for 3,6-dimethoxy-2-propan-2-yl-5-[1-[4-(trifluoromethyl)phenyl]ethyl]-2,5-dihydropyrazine?
The canonical SMILES for 3,6-dimethoxy-2-propan-2-yl-5-[1-[4-(trifluoromethyl)phenyl]ethyl]-2,5-dihydropyrazine is COC1=NC(C(C)c2ccc(C(F)(F)F)cc2)C(OC)=NC1C(C)C.
What is the InChIKey of 3,6-dimethoxy-2-propan-2-yl-5-[1-[4-(trifluoromethyl)phenyl]ethyl]-2,5-dihydropyrazine?
The InChIKey is SNJYXOYLYNKBRA-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C18H23F3N2O2/c1-10(2)14-16(24-4)23-15(17(22-14)25-5)11(3)12-6-8-13(9-7-12)18(19,20)21/h6-11,14-15H,1-5H3.
What are the key properties of 3,6-dimethoxy-2-propan-2-yl-5-[1-[4-(trifluoromethyl)phenyl]ethyl]-2,5-dihydropyrazine?
3,6-dimethoxy-2-propan-2-yl-5-[1-[4-(trifluoromethyl)phenyl]ethyl]-2,5-dihydropyrazine has a molecular weight of 356.39 g/mol, XLogP of 4.31, 3 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 4 hydrogen bond acceptors.
